>How about <spisat'sia>?  Like in: Ya spisalsia s professorom Goscilo po voprosu
>svoego uchastiia v yeyo "paneli."

Certainly. There is a book by Maria Rutkowska "Nie znane polszczyznie
rosyjskie prefigowane deriwaty odczasownikowe..." (Wroclaw 1981). Although
if I remember correctly she did not include all possible circumfixes. But
s- -sja is one of those that are there: spet'sja, srabotat'sja etc. Another
source for circumfixes is the last section in Vinogradov's Russkij jazyk,
the last of 15 (if I remember the number correctly) usages of -sja is this
"joint venture". (Can't find my copy at the moment to check the number!)
